Amorphis - To Release New Live Album


Amorphis are delighted to announce their third live album Queen Of Time (Live At Tavastia 2021), which is set to be released on October 13th 2023 via Atomic Fire Records. It was recorded in the year of the corona-pandemic. When the music world was forced into a standstill, the band played two streaming concerts at the legendary Tavastia Club in Helsinki. The band also unveiled a first single, the energetic yet beautifully melancholic "Amongst Stars", featuring guest vocalist Anneke Van Giersbergen.




Keyboardist Santeri Kallio recalls: "Firstly I thought it would feel like a long soundcheck, but quite contrary it felt pretty close to a real concert. Of course the band had to take the energy boost only from each otherโ€™s playing and rely on the feelings what the songs bring in. Obviously there was zero support nor energy help from audiences side. Everybody probably agrees nothing beats performing in front of the live audience, but I think we survived extremely well. One of the good sides was that everybody had to concentrate just for the music and playing 100% thus it was just one-shot chance."
